Pras Michel, the rapper and record producer best known as a founding member of the Fugees, was recently spotted on the wrist with an Audemars Piguet Millenary in 18K rose gold, reference 15320OR — a watch that sits quietly outside the Royal Oak's enormous shadow and is better for it.

The Millenary line traces its roots to 1995, when Audemars Piguet introduced the oval case as a deliberate counterpoint to both the Royal Oak's angular sports DNA and the brand's more classical round dress pieces. Reference 15320OR represents a mature iteration of that concept, cased in warm 18K pink gold measuring approximately 47mm in its characteristic off-round profile. The movement inside is the calibre 3120, a 60-hour power reserve automatic with a 22K gold rotor, operating at 21,600 vph. It is an in-house manufacture movement and one of AP's most reliable workhorses, shared with certain Royal Oak references — a detail that underlines its pedigree without requiring explanation.

Among collectors, the Millenary occupies an interesting position. It has never commanded the waitlists or grey-market premiums of the Royal Oak or Royal Oak Offshore, which makes it genuinely accessible by Audemars Piguet standards. For serious horological enthusiasts, that relative obscurity is a selling point — the Millenary rewards knowledge over logo recognition. The 15320OR in rose gold threads a careful line: the precious metal gives it warmth and occasion-appropriate weight, while the open-worked or partially exposed movement architecture ensures it reads as a watchmaker's piece first.
